Output ed03668e35d1fc11e746a731a987d984cefbeaaa38ebd26ea070ebe125f0551b:73

value
5659886
script pubkey
OP_0 OP_PUSHBYTES_20 c33af56b0c4bc622d63d307d5697d210f25680c8
address
bc1qcva026cvf0rz943axp74d97jzre9dqxgg0kddf
transaction
ed03668e35d1fc11e746a731a987d984cefbeaaa38ebd26ea070ebe125f0551b